Traditional notepad applications lack markdown support, forcing users to either use bloated electron-based editors (VS Code, Obsidian) that consume 500MB+ RAM, or plain text editors without formatting preview. Technical users, developers, and markdown writers need a fast, lightweight editor that provides real-time markdown rendering without sacrificing performance or simplicity.
Primary Persona: Technical Writer / Developer
- Writes documentation, notes, READMEs daily
- Values keyboard shortcuts and efficiency
- Needs quick startup for jotting ideas
- Works across Windows, macOS, Linux
- Frustrated by slow, bloated editors
Secondary Persona: Markdown Enthusiast
- Uses markdown for personal notes, blogs
- Wants live preview while writing
- Appreciates clean, distraction-free UI
- May not know all markdown syntax by heart
- Startup time: < 500ms cold start
- Memory usage: < 50MB RAM idle, < 100MB active
- Binary size: < 50MB compiled
- Markdown rendering: Matches CommonMark spec
- Cross-platform: Runs identically on Windows, macOS, Linux
- Session persistence: 100% restore of tabs/state on restart

}| Component | Technology | Rationale |
|---|---|---|
| Language | Rust 1.70+ | Performance, safety, cross-platform |
| GUI | egui 0.28 + eframe 0.28 | Immediate mode, fast, portable |
| Markdown | comrak 0.22 | CommonMark compliant, fast |
| Syntax | syntect 5.1 | Sublime Text highlighting engine |
| Config | serde + serde_json | Standard Rust serialization |
| Paths | dirs 5 | Platform-specific directories |
| Links | open 5 | Open URLs in default browser |
| File watch | notify 6 | Cross-platform file watching |
Decision: egui over other GUI frameworks
- Rationale: Immediate mode GUI is simpler, faster to iterate, smaller binary
- Trade-offs: Less native look than Qt/GTK, but consistent cross-platform
- Alternatives considered: Tauri (Electron-like size), Druid (less mature), GTK-rs (complex)
Risk: egui text editing may not match native feel
- Impact: Medium - affects daily usability
- Likelihood: Medium
- Mitigation: Test early with real users, iterate on feedback
- Fallback: Custom text widget implementation if needed
Risk: Syntax highlighting performance on large files
- Impact: High - core feature
- Likelihood: Low (syntect is battle-tested)
- Mitigation: Lazy highlighting, viewport-only rendering
- Fallback: Disable highlighting for files > 1MB
Risk: Cross-platform file dialog inconsistencies
- Impact: Low - cosmetic issue
- Likelihood: Medium
- Mitigation: Test on all platforms, use rfd crate for native dialogs
- Fallback: Custom file browser widget
Risk: Feature creep beyond MVP
- Impact: High - delays launch
- Likelihood: Medium
- Mitigation: Strict phase gating, defer nice-to-haves to Phase 2+
- Fallback: Ship MVP without polish features if needed
Risk: egui breaking changes in future versions
- Impact: Medium
- Likelihood: Low (0.28 is stable)
- Mitigation: Lock dependency versions, test upgrades in branch
- Fallback: Stay on current version
- CommonMark: Standardized markdown specification
- Immediate Mode GUI: UI paradigm where widgets are recreated each frame
- AST: Abstract Syntax Tree - parsed representation of markdown
